a couple of other things...
- The serial numbers are unique.... my 552 is 2201
- You can get an 8.4v mini nanchuk battery in it....here's a link to a thread I made for a mod to fit an 8.4v mini NiMH battery.
http://www.airsoftcanada.com/showthr...52+battery+mod
- I put a piece of black vinyl (cut from a black 3 ring binder) in the top half of handguard so you can't see the battery and wires through the holes.. It is just a rectangle of it, and it's just placed in loose in the handguard.

TM lowcaps work flawlessly in them, and MAG brand mags work too... after they get modded a bit. (they need a light filing on the front mag lip.)
